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Nilgiri langur | Pea weevil |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Primates (Primates) | Coleoptera (Beetles) |
| Family |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) | Chrysomelidae |
| Genus | Semnopithecus | Bruchus |
| Species | Semnopithecus johnii | Bruchus pisorum |
